Residents in Tororo district have asked president Yoweri Kagutta Museveni to expedite the operationalisation of newly created districts and elevate Municipality to city status.
Tororo district is comprised of thirty two (32) sub-counties, ten (10)Town councils and one Municipality.
Now, the proposal to create the new three districts from Tororo was proposed in the NRM party caucus and then tabled to cabinet pending the operationalisation. The proposed new districts are, Mukuju, Mulanda and Kisoko.
The request was presented during Museveni’s rally in Tororo town on Friday by Tororo County NRM party chairman, Othieno Godfrey Otabong, for the president to effect the operationalisation of the districts within this financial year.
Apollo Ofwono Yeri, the Tororo district NRM party chairman said that the creation of the new districts has resolved the conflicts of tribalism between the Itesot and Jopadhola that has been there for long, and elevate Tororo Municipality to city status.
Ofwono Yeri appealed to the president to help so that they can tamarck the 40 kilometre Nagongera to Busaba Road and another 17 kilometer of Tororo-Nagongera- Kisoko Road. He says this will help improve on proper movement of people and business.
President Museveni asked residents of Tororo and Bukedi at large to learn the value of the good roads that are already worked on, to develop themselves.
He cited the benefits the ruling party has enabled like peace and security,econom ic and and social infrastructure, pushing Uganda to middle income status.
President Yoweri Museveni promised to ensure all the lower health facilities be elevated from health center IIs to III, then those at level of 3 to four and Tororo be given regional hospital.
He promised to make a follow up with the office of the Antony General over the operationalisation of the newly created 3 districts and elevation of Tororo Municipality to city status.
